一、 选择最优美国基础设施的关键因素
成功的区块链节点运维始于对美国服务器基础设施的明智选择。地理位置直接影响节点的网络延迟和响应速度,选择靠近主要用户群或网络交换中心的美国数据中心(如弗吉尼亚州阿什本、加利福尼亚州硅谷)能显著提升交易广播与区块同步效率。网络质量是另一生命线,需评估数据中心提供商的全球骨干网络接入能力(如Tier 1运营商互联)、冗余带宽保障及先进的BGP网络(边界网关协议,实现最优路由选择)配置。硬件配置需匹配特定区块链协议(如以太坊、Solana)的资源需求,高性能CPU、充足内存(RAM)、具备高IOPS的SSD存储不可或缺。美国服务器的优势还在于严格的物理安全保障、全天候电力冗余及成熟的灾难恢复机制,为节点提供坚实物理基础。
二、 部署环境:从云服务到独立服务器
部署区块链节点有两种主要路径:云服务(AWS, GCP, Azure)和独立服务器租用。云服务的弹性伸缩能力便于处理区块链状态暴涨或流量高峰,按需付费模式也可优化初期成本。云平台通常集成强大的监控、备份和安全工具。对于资源消耗极高、追求极致性能或严格数据隐私的特定区块链项目(如某些需要定制化内核优化的企业级应用),租用独立服务器/裸金属服务器(Bare Metal)提供了独占硬件资源和完全的管理权限优势。但用户需自行配置软件栈、安全防护和维护系统更新。无论选择哪种方式,在美国部署时必须考虑节点类型(全节点、存档节点、验证者节点)对资源的差异要求,存档节点通常需要TB级别的存储空间。
三、 安全加固:守护区块链节点与数据核心
部署在美国服务器的区块链节点面临诸多安全威胁(DDoS攻击、未授权访问、恶意软件)。首要任务是配置严格的防火墙规则,仅开放必要端口(如P2P协议端口、特定RPC/API端口),并实施基于密钥认证的SSH登录,彻底禁用密码认证。操作系统和节点软件(如Geth、Prysm)的及时更新至关重要,修补已知漏洞。实施零信任架构(Zero Trust,即默认不信任任何内外网络流量)理念,限制内部进程权限,并考虑网络隔离策略。加密所有敏感数据传输(使用SSH隧道、VPN或TLS),即使是内部通信也应加密。针对DDoS攻击,可以利用提供商的专业DDoS防护服务(美国顶级数据中心通常具备强大的抗D能力),并配置流量限速规则。
四、 持续监控与性能调优:保障节点稳定高效
持续监控是区块链节点运维的心脏。利用如Prometheus + Grafana、Zabbix或云平台原生工具,实时监控关键指标:CPU使用率、内存占用、磁盘IOPS/容量、网络带宽/丢包率、节点进程状态、区块同步高度差、内存池交易数。设置智能告警阈值,在资源瓶颈或服务异常时即时通知运维团队。遇到节点同步缓慢问题?可能需检查网络路径质量、提高数据库(如LevelDB)缓存大小或优化磁盘读写策略。区块验证速度慢或内存溢出,则需分析资源分配是否充足(如调整JVM堆大小)。优化数据库性能(尤其是使用冷热分离存储归档历史数据)和清理无用状态数据也是提升节点长期运行效率的关键。定期健康检查脚本能自动化验证核心功能。
五、 自动化运维与灾难恢复策略
将区块链节点运维工作流自动化是提升效率、减少人为错误的核心。使用Ansible、Terraform或Chef等工具自动化服务器初始化、节点软件安装、配置文件管理及安全策略部署。自动定时快照(Snapshots)能快速回滚至稳定状态。关键是要实现自动备份:定期将节点的链数据、钱包文件、密钥和配置文件备份至异地存储(如另一区域的美国数据中心或对象存储服务),加密存储。开发严谨的灾难恢复计划并定期演练,包括服务器故障时的快速迁移流程、数据恢复步骤。高可用(HA)配置如主备节点切换或使用负载均衡器(针对只读节点集群)能显著提升服务持续性。
六、 应对合规挑战与成本管控
在美国服务器上运维区块链节点必须严格遵循当地法律框架。了解美国不同州对数据存储的特定要求(如加州CCPA)、金融服务机构监管要求(如货币传输牌照相关影响)以及潜在的AML/KYC义务至关重要。选择合规的数据中心合作伙伴是基础。成本管控同样重要:精确计算不同服务器配置的成本结构(硬件、带宽、IP地址费用)。精细化流量监控能避免超额带宽费用。对非实时访问的历史链数据,采用经济高效的冷热分离存储策略(如高性能本地SSD存热数据 + 低成本对象存储存冷数据)可大幅降低成本。定期审计资源使用情况,避免为闲置资源付费。